Objective To investigate the iconographic characteristics and clinical significances of synchronic examination of indocyanine green angiography (ICGA) and fundus fluorescein angiography (FFA) for high myopia.Methods Thirty patients (57 eyes) with high myopia(gt;-6.00D), selected randomly and consecutively, were examined by ICGA and FFA synchronically.Results The result of early phase of FFA showed hypofluorescence of the background in 25 eyes,while of late phase showed subretinal neovascularization (SRNV) in 10 eyes and streak formation in 40 eyes. The result of ICGA showed choroidal retrobulbar arteries in 8 eyes, hypofluorescence of the background in 35 eyes, SRNV in 8 eyes, and streak formation in 52 eyes.Conclusion The iconographic characteristics of ICGA and FFA of high myopia include hypofluorescence of the background, SRNV and streak formation. ICGA can givemore exact information on the lesions of choroid in high myopia. The synchronic examination of ICGA and FFA may act as a guide to the therapy for high myopia.(Chin J Ocul Fundus Dis,2003,19:87-89)
OBJECTIVE:To elucidate the nature of degenerations in canine peripheral retina and compare the degenerations with those in human peripheral retina. METHODS: Examining randomly the peripberal fundus of eighty eye balls of forty dogs wdh dissecting microscope. The lesions of degenerations were photographed and processed for light microscopic examination. RESULTS:Typical Cystoid degeneralion,reticular degenerative retinoschisis, paving-stone degeneration, and lattice degeneration were discovered. The pathologic findings of these degenerations were same as or similar to those of the degenerations in human peripheral retina. CONCLUSIONS:The atrophic retinal degenerations that are similar to human' s are present at peripheral fundus in canine eyes. (Chin J Ocul Fundus Dis,1996,12: 151-152)
OBJECTIVE:To inwestigate the value of fundus fluorescein angiography in evaluation of idiopathic senile macular hole(ISMH). METHODS:fundus fluorescein angiography(FFA)and other clinical examination were performed in 26 cases (31eyes)of ISMH patients. RESULTS:Full-thickness macular holes were in 17 and lamellar holes were in 14 of the 31 eyes. Hyperfluorescencequot;window defectquot;was found at the base of all the eyes with full-thickness maeular holes and 2 eyes with lamellar holes. The size of hyperfluorescence zone was smaller than that of those seen in redfree film, hyperfluorescence in 6 eyes (19.4%) showed homogenous ancl 10 eyes (32.5%) granular in pattern. The small yellowish dots in macular hole showed blocked fluorescence,while the halo of macular hole showed hyperfluorescence. CONCLUSION:Fundus fluorescein angiography was useful in differentiating lamellar from full-thickness macular hole and understanding the degree of retinal pigment epithelium damages in macular holes. (Chin J Ocul Fundus Dis,1996,12: 208-210 )
Objective To compare the characteristics of the results of fundus fluorescein angiography (FFA) and indocyanine green angiography (ICGA) in patients with classic choroidal neovasculazation (CNV). Methods The data of FFA and ICGA of 34 patients (36 eyes) with classic CNV were analyzed retrospectively and the results of the two examinations were analyzed contrastively. Results The results of FFA revealed the clew or cartheel-tike configuration of classic CNV at the early phase in 3 out of 15 eyes (20%) with age-related macular degeneration (AMD); in 5 out of 7 eyes with pathological myopia(71.4%); and in 9 out of 14 eyes with central exudative chorioretinopathy (CEC),(64.3%),In 36 eyes with classic CNV, the images of ICGA indicated CNV distinctly in 20 (55.6%) and indistinctly in 15 (41.6%); CNV was not detected by ICGA in 1 eye (2.8%); feeding blood vessels in 6 eyes (16.7%) were detected by ICGA but none by FFA. Conclusions At the early phase of FFA, the configuration of classic CNV is clew-like in eyes with pathological myopia and CEC, and erose in eyes with AMD. The image of ICGA which indicated the outline of classic CNV is not as clear as the one of FFA, but it can reveal the feeding vessels which FFA can not. (Chin J Ocul Fundus Dis, 2006, 22: 217-209)
ObjectiveTo observe the features of the manifestations of fundus fluorescein angiography (FFA) in multiple sclerosis (MS) and their value in clinical diagnosis.MethodsThe clinical data of 42 patients (84 eyes) with MS diagnosed by magnetic resonance imaging (MRI) and examination of cerebrospinal fluid (CSF) were retrospectively analyzed. The clinical data included visual acuity, ocular fundus examined by direct ophthalmoscope after mydriasis, FFA, visual field, CSF,visual evoked potential (VEP) and MRI examination.ResultsIn 42 patients (84 eyes),the positive detectable rate of examination of direct ophthalmoscope, CSF, visual field, VEP, and MRI was 36.9%, 21.4%, 71.4%, and 83.3% respectively. Abnormal results of FFA were found in 44 eyes (52.38%), including papillitis in 4 eyes(4.76%)at the early stage with extended physiological scotoma and central scotoma; neuroretinitis in 7 eyes (8.33%)at the medium stage with central or para-central scotoma; optic atrophy in 33 eyes(39.29%) at the late stage with centripetal constriction and even tubular visual field. ConclusionThe main angiographic features of MS are papillitis, neuroretinitis and optic atrophy. The manifestations of FFA combined with the results of examination of CSF,visual field, VEP and MRI is helpful for comprehensive and exact diagnosis of MS.(Chin J Ocul Fundus Dis, 2005,21:300-302)
Objective To observe the change of retinal artery angle in eyes with idiopathic epiretinal membrane (ERM) and to analyze the relationship between retinal artery angle, ERM classification based on optical coherence tomography (OCT), and visual acuity. MethodsA retrospective cross-sectional clinical study. A total of 187 eyes in 187 patients diagnosed with monocular idiopathic ERM (IERM group) in Department of Ophthalmology of Zhejiang Provincial People's Hospital and the Affiliated Eye Hospital of Wenzhou Medical University at Hangzhou from November 2018 to January 2023 were included in the study. The contralateral healthy eyes were included as the control group. All patients underwent best corrected visual acuity (BCVA), fundus photography, spectral-domain OCT, OCT angiography (OCTA) and axial length (AL) measurement. BCVA examination was performed using the standard logarithmic visual acuity chart, which was converted to the logarithm of the minimum angle of resolution (logMAR) visual acuity. The foveal avascular zone (FAZ) area was measured by OCTA. The central macular thickness (CMT) was measured by spectral domain OCTaccording to the grading criteria of ectopic inner foveal layer (EIFL) was divided into stages 1 to 4 with 42, 45, 62, and 38 eyes, and the IERM group was subdivided into stage 1, stage 2, stage 3, and stage 4 groups accordingly. Image J was used to measure the retinal artery angle and the 1/2 retinal artery angle on fundus images. Multiple linear regression analysis was used to analyze the correlation between BCVA and artery angle, 1/2 artery Angle, CMT, FAZ area and AL. ResultsCompared with the control group, eyes in IERM group had worse BCVA (t=9.727), thicker CMT (t=12.452), smaller FAZ area (t=-14.329), smaller artery angle (t=-9.165) and smaller 1/2 artery angle (t=-9.549). The differences were statistically significant (P<0.001). With the increase of IERM stage, the artery angle and 1/2 artery angle decreased significantly (F=21.763, 12.515; P<0.001). There was no significant difference in artery angle and 1/2 artery angle between stage 1 group and stage 2 group, and 1/2 arterial angle between stage 2 group and stage 3 group (P>0.05). There were significant differences in artery angle and 1/2 artery angle between the other groups (P<0.05). There were significant differences in CMT and logMAR BCVA among different classification subgroups in IERM groups (P<0.05). There was no significant difference in FAZ area between grade 3 group and grade 4 group (P>0.05). There were significant differences in FAZ area between the other groups (P<0.05). Correlation analysis showed that decreased artery angle (P=0.013) and increased CMT (P<0.001) were associated with decreased BCVA. ConclusionsCompared with healthy eyes, the artery angle decreases significantly with the increase of ERM stage. Decreased retinal artery angle is associated with decreased visual acuity in IERM eyes.
Purpose To observe the clinical features and visual acuity of the eyes with idiopathic macular holes. Methods We reviewed the clinical materials of 23eyes of 18 patients with idiopathic macular holes and the follow up results from 6 to 120 months. Results In the initial examinations of 22 eyes,the numbers of eyes with stagesⅠ-Ⅳ macular holes were5,4,10,3 eyes respectively,and funds fluorescein angiography showed there were focal transmission of choroidal fluorescein in 17 eyes (stagesⅡ~Ⅳ).Macular hole ocurred in one eyes during follow up.At the final examination of 23 eyes,the numbers of eyes with stages Ⅰ~Ⅳ macular holes were 2,2,9,8 eyes respectively .Full-thickness macular hole of 2 eyes closed naturally after posterior vitreous detachment.The time interval of the subjective visual loss on stage Ⅰ was 5-8 months,stageⅡ8-20 months,stageⅢ12-126 months ,and the average visual acuity on stageⅠwas 0.7,stage 0.55,stageⅢ0.08,and stage Ⅳ0.08 Conclusion Approximately 60% of impending (stage Ⅰ) hole progress to full thickness holes, the full thickness holes were usually enlarged and the visual acuity of affected eyes decreased as the natural course was prolonged . (Chin J Ocul Fundus Dis,1998,14:222-223)

Chronic disease is a major threat to human health. Fundus disease has become a major ophthalmic disease affecting daily life. Although great breakthroughs have been made in the treatment, compared with other chronic disease management, the management of patients with fundus disease is still in its infancy. To strengthen the management exploration of patients with fundus diseases, establish a management model of fundus diseases and strive to improve patients' awareness of fundus diseases and adherence to treatment and follow-up are the great challenges at present. All ophthalmic centers should strengthen patient education, establish a regional cooperation network, support the construction of grassroots medical capacity, cultivate talents, enhance training, promote the standardized treatment of fundus diseases, standardize fundus imaging inspection and diagnosis, and promote the homogeneous construction of diagnosis and treatment of chronic fundus diseases. We will accelerate the construction of a hierarchical diagnosis and treatment system and the ability to link consultation and referral. Through systematic management and intervention of fundus diseases, a large number of patients with fundus diseases will receive early screening, diagnosis, standardized continuous treatment and systematic management, and improve the quality of life of patients with fundus diseases.
